Definitions of "Inity and Love"


1. Inity and Love (Noun)


Definition

A phrase emphasizing the principles of unity and love as central tenets of Rastafarian beliefs and the pursuit of social justice and equality


Example Sentences

Patois: Wi strive fi di upliftment of all through inity and love
English: We strive for the upliftment of all through unity and love

Iyaric: The Language of Rastafari

One of the key elements of the Rastafari language is the use of what is called "Iyaric," a form of Jamaican Patois that is considered to be the "holy language" of Rastafarians. Iyaric, also known as Dread Talk, is the Rastafari language created in defiance of English as an imposed colonial language that facilitated the loss of African languages among enslaved Afro-Caribbeans.
